Vulnerability Insight:
A Client Authentication Bypass vulnerability has been discovered in the concurrent, real-time, distributed functional language Erlang. Impacted are those who are running an ssl/tls/dtls server using the ssl application either directly or indirectly via other applications. Note that the vulnerability only affects servers that request client certification, that is sets the option {verify, verify_peer}.

Additionally the source package elixir-lang has been rebuilt against the new erlang version. The rabbitmq-server package was upgraded to version 3.8.2 to fix an incompatibility with Erlang 22.

For Debian 10 buster, this problem has been fixed in version 1:22.2.7+dfsg-1+deb10u1.

We recommend that you upgrade your erlang packages.
